This full-time role (37.5 hours/week, NSY) provides a unique blend of responsibilities across both high school and elementary settings: Serve approximately 12 high school students (class numbers usually 8-9) Guide about 6 elementary students with the support of two classroom assistants Utilize your EMD licensure to deliver specialized instruction and foster a nurturing, inclusive environment
Qualifications:
Valid Special Education Teacher credentials (EMD license required) Experience working with high school and/or elementary students with special needs Strong communication, collaboration, and classroom management skills Ability to adapt lessons to a variety of learning abilities Desire to grow through travel and embrace new educational challenges
Responsibilities:
Develop and implement tailored Individualized Education Programs (IEPs) Collaborate with assistants and general education staff Promote a supportive, positive environment for all learners Assess and monitor student progress, adjusting strategies as needed Engage with parents and teams for holistic student development
